> Log:
> Oops. back out last commit. The data and stack limits are used by the
> 32 bit binary stuff. 32 bit binaries do not like it much when the kernel
> tries hard to put things above the 8GB mark.
>
> I have a work-in-progress to fix this properly, but I didn't want to burn
> anybody with this yet.
BTW: ia64 suffers from the same. p4 stopped working when I bumped
the datalimit on pluto2 for dds at ...
If there's anything we need to do for ia64, let me know.
